Intelligence influences how we learn, solve problems, adapt to new situations, and interact with others. Yet, despite its importance, the question “What is intelligence?” remains one of the most debated in psychology and neuroscience.

The study of intelligence is central to psychology because it intersects cognition, personality, learning, and social behavior. Intelligence is commonly understood as the capacity to acquire and apply knowledge, adapt to new situations, reason effectively, and solve problems.
